Blue sapphires are highly durable gems, ranking just below diamonds on the Mohs scale. This remarkable durability makes them an excellent choice for everyday wear, but even the toughest stones require careful maintenance to preserve their beauty.
To protect your ring from everyday wear and tear, consider adopting these simple habits:
- Avoid Wearing During Certain Activities: Remove your ring while engaging in activities that could expose it to rough surfaces or harsh chemicals, such as gardening, cleaning, or swimming.
- Apply Beauty Products First: Before putting on your ring, apply lotions, perfumes, and hair products to avoid residue buildup on the gemstone.
- Gentle Handling: Handle your ring with care, avoiding unnecessary pressure or impact on the stone.
Regular cleaning is crucial to maintaining the brilliance of your blue sapphire. Here are some safe and effective cleaning techniques:
- Mild Soap and Water: Use a soft brush and mild soap mixed with lukewarm water to gently clean your ring. Rinse thoroughly and dry with a lint-free cloth.
- Avoid Harsh Chemicals: Steer clear of cleaners containing bleach or abrasives, as these can damage the sapphire and its setting.
- Consult Your Jeweler: If you're unsure about home cleaning, consult your jeweler, who can provide the best advice for your specific ring.
Even with diligent at-home care, professional maintenance is vital:
- Routine Inspections: Schedule annual inspections with a jeweler to check for loose settings or stone damage.
- Professional Cleaning: A jeweler can provide a deep clean and polish, restoring the stone's natural shine and ensuring the setting remains secure.
Proper storage is key to preserving your ring's condition:
- Separate Storage: Store your ring in a soft-lined jewelry box or pouch, separate from other pieces, to prevent scratches.
- Avoid Extreme Temperatures: Keep your ring away from extreme heat or cold, which can affect the metal setting and adhesive used in some designs.
Given their value, insuring your blue sapphire solitaire engagement ring is wise:
- Jewelry Insurance: Protects against loss, theft, or damage, offering peace of mind.
- Regular Appraisals: Ensure your ring is appraised regularly to keep track of its current market value, which is essential for accurate insurance coverage.
